  6. Do you use 56k or ISDN ? I think that is the important question. ISDN is somewhere between 56k and ADSL. I would be surprised if you used 56k, because you live farthest away from me, and still the latency is only about 220 ms. I have experience from all types of connections with NHL94. I started with 56k in the first league we had in 2001, and I barely made the playoffs. in 2001 there wasn't p2p mode, so all games had to be played in servers. With 56k I usually got about 170-200 ms to the swedish server (which equals 360-400 ms in p2p). I got ISDN to the playoffs and it made all the difference. I felt like a cow on a summer pasture (Finnish phrase). Latency dropped to 99 ms (200 ms p2p). I reached the finals with ISDN which I feel I couldn't have done with 56k. The southern Finland's opponents already had ADSL connection (I quess it became more common there before because of the big cities). Their latency to the server was around 20-40 ms. Now playing with ADSL and in p2p mode it feels almost like offline game to play against other Finns, and about the same that it was with ISDN against North Americans.

  18. FPB is absolutely correct. We didn't make the rule to stop FPB trading himself a superstar to his team. First of all, the rule was made to make sure the trading system wasn't abused, for example taking advantage of novice players and their unfamiliarity of GDL players. This was to make sure any title contender would not have too superior team compared to others. The trades can still be made, but trading commitee will review all trades including top10 picks for potential title contenders. I actually encourage to try it so the commitee actions can be seen and improvements can be made if necessary. Secondly this does not only concern FPB, but all the other potential title contenders aswell, like IceStorm. This will and must be handled according to the rules. Since trading commitee will consist of swos, vocally caged and IceStorm, we will have to find some other veteran player to review IceStorm's trade, because naturally he cannot make decisions for himself. If 2 out of 3 of trading commitee allows the trade, it's approved. Now about reviewing a trade there's important things to pay attention to: - how equal are the traded players compared to eachother, and what will the teams look like before and after the trade. It's very hard or next to impossible to foresee how the teams will look like if the trade only consist of picks. If the trade consists of already drafted player it is much easier to see the outcome of the trade. - how dominant players/superstars are we talking about. We decided to review all trades including top10 picks for now, but naturally we are talking about much more dominant players in top5 compared to 10th pick. This is a line that still needs reviewing, and it helps to have these kinds of trades so they can be reviewed.
